  • Dalhousie University offers a Master of Science in Medical Physics for a duration of 2 years.
  • It is an on-campus program offered on a full-time.
  • At Dalhousie, students can pursue CAMPEP-accredited master's and doctoral degrees that provide the foundational knowledge required to pursue a career involving clinical service, research, and teaching in medical physics.
  • This program combines course and research work that builds critical knowledge in the field with hands-on training that prepares students for rewarding careers.
  • The courses in the program provide students with the medical physics foundations specified within the CAMPEP standards.
  • All required coursework is completed in the first year and students focus on their thesis research in the second year and and is to be completed by the end of the Summer term.
  • The course work and practical training in the programs can position students for  a dynamic and versatile career in physics as applied to diagnosis and treatment of patients. 
  • The faculty provides a highly collaborative, collegial learning environment that features world-class research facilities and technology.
  • Graduates of all of the programs are eligible to enter residency training programs in imaging or radiation oncology medical physics.
  • the department provides the professors that are not only driven to succeed in their own research careers but they also want to ensure their students achieve academic success and are willing to share their expertise both inside and outside the classroom
  • MSc graduates may go on to pursue PhD degree programs, enter residency training programs in imaging or therapeutic medical physics, or enter the workforce directly.

Eligibility & Entry Requirement

Academic Eligibility:

  • Students should have completed a 4-year bachelor's degree from a recognized university.
  • A minimum GPA of at least 3.0/4.33 (B grade) in the last 60 credit hours of study is required to be eligible for the program.

Indian Student Eligibility:

Indian students are eligible to apply if they meet one of the following eligibility criteria:

  • Completed a 4-year UG degree with first class in a relevant field from a recognized institution.
  • Or, completed a master's degree with first-class in a relevant field from a recognized institution.
  • Or, completed a 3-year undergraduate degree from an accredited institution.

Submission of GRE scores is not compulsory for this program, however, it is recommended to submit the scores (minimum 300) for a better chance of admission.

Along with the minimum eligibility requirements, international students hailing from non-English speaking countries need to prove English proficiency through IELTS/TOEFL/any equivalent test.

Required Document List

Following are the required document:

  • Online application form and fees: Students have to fill the online form and submit the application fees. 
  • Resume: Outline of academic achievements and/or awards, publications, relevant work, and/or volunteer experience.
  • Two Professional References: Referees (Teachers, guidance counselors, or Professors) should comment on academics and that references should submit along with the application system.
  • Personal Statement: It should include a brief overview of themselves, strengths, and any work experience and/or education that students have.
  • Transcripts: Students have to submit transcripts from all universities/colleges attended, World Education Services Assessments, and English Language Proficiency test scores.
  • Statement of Intent: Reasons or intentions for pursuing studies in this program, including a description of prior experience.
  • Confirmation of Employment Form:  Students must be emailed as an attachment by applicant or referee. 
  • Proof of name change: Required only if name discrepancies exist between transcripts/assessments/test scores and other application documents.  Examples of proof: Marriage/divorce certificates, 2 copies of government-issued ID that include a previous and current name and date of birth.
  • ELP Scores: Students have to submit their English language proficiency scores like IELTS, TOEFL, or other test scores.
